      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hello,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I've got a large .tif that I am trying to break up to match our city grid layer. I want individual rasters that match with the individual grids. I thought the "Split Raster" tool in Pro would be what I needed to use so that I do not have to do each one individually, which would be a pain because there are 200+ individual grid blocks.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;But when I run this tool it "Succeeds" after only 2 seconds, and gives me absolutely nothing in the Output Folder that I set. What am I dong wrong?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;IMG class="image-1 jive-image" src="https://community.esri.com/legacyfs/online/381290_pastedImage_1.png" style="width: 246px; height: 642px;" /&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Yes, when I open the folder I set as the output folder, there is absolutely nothing there. This is a big enough raster that there is no way, if it were actually successful, that it would finish in 2 seconds.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;They have different coordinate systems. My polygon is NAD 1983 StatePlane California VI FIPS 0406 Feet and my raster is GCS North American 1983. I didn't think this would make a difference since they line up correctly on my map.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;lining up on the map is not relevant... that is purely a visual convenience.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;There is&lt;A href="http://pro.arcgis.com/en/pro-app/tool-reference/data-management/split-raster.htm"&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t; no indication in the help&lt;/STRONG&gt; &lt;/A&gt;that a Projection of the polygon layer will be done... that would be an omission if that is the case.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If Projecting the layer to match the coordinate system of the raster (using the Project Tool) doesn't work then there could be other issues.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;UL&gt;&lt;LI&gt;make sure you specify a file extension (*.tif)&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;you could be running into a memory issue, in this case nothing is produced, so try clipping a smaller area or use &lt;STRONG&gt;Background Geoprocessing&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;if your clip extent shapes are regular, enter the rows and columns manually using one of the other two options.&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;/UL&gt;&lt;P&gt;My recommendation would be try the project first, then if that doesn't work, a smaller area&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Changing the projection did make it work, thank you. One more question, do you know a way that I can make the output file name include a specific attribute? It gives me the ability to state what I want the base to be, but the final output seems to be Basename_OID.tif, when instead I would like Basename_[NAME].tif. NAME being one of the fields in the polygon I am using for the split.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thank you!&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Cynthia...&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Not from the interface, the basename option only allows you to specify the basename then it assigns a number. &am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You will have to document your process so that you remember.&amp;nbsp; Otherwise, you have the task of coding a batch rename.&amp;nbsp; You have to weigh the need against the time trying to find code that will do the job in all situations.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In situations like that... create a folder with the desired name and/or a geodatabase with the desired name, so that you know that everything that is in there is based on your desired field. &am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
